For individuals navigating the financial landscape without a traditional bank account, understanding the check-cashing definition is the first step toward financial autonomy. The Mechanics of Check Cashing At its core, the check-cashing definition centers on the verification and conversion of a written order to pay a specific amount of money.

While often viewed as a last resort, these transactions serve a vital function in the modern economy, providing access to funds for millions who might otherwise be excluded from the formal financial system. For immigrants, the elderly, or those recovering from financial hardship, these outlets provide a crucial lifeline.
